    I have just read the Chairmans report as I usually do, and most of the time think that valid topics are bought up and he usually just says what most of us know anyrate. Today however I read about the "boo few" and to be quite honest I am getting tired of it. The people who boo do so for a reason (I'd just like to point out that I NEVER boo!), and that reason is that they are disgruntled with what is being put out in front of them. They don't boo cos they are bored or for a joke - it's because of the crap that is being played out in front of them. We were promised exciting attacking football, we are gonna go for it, is one of the quotes that sticks in my mind. Well I aint seen any sign of it so far - I think it took about 60 mins last Saturday to get the first real attempt on goal. So now we have the chairman and the manager having a go at the fans, when in all fairness they should be looking at themselves in the mirror and deciding where the blame should rest! Don't alienate the fans - Don't patronise the fans - play some football and we will get behind the team. Years and years of promises and false hope which this season was pumped up by the Management to a new level - only to tell us we are wrong because we believed you!! Nuf said!
